"error: possibly undefined macro: AC_PROG_LIBTOOL" from autogen.sh

Downloaded quantlib 0.8.1 and get everything (examples and test-suited) compiled and run.

But I could not get autogen.sh work, here is the complete error message:

********************************************************************************
$ ./autogen.sh
configure.ac:63: error: possibly undefined macro: AC_PROG_LIBTOOL
      If this token and others are legitimate, please use m4_pattern_allow.
      See the Autoconf documentation.
autoreconf: /ms/user/w/wguo/autoconf-2.61/bin/autoconf failed with exit status: 1

Run the command ./configure --help for information on options
that can change the behavior of the library.
********************************************************************************

I am using automake(1.9.6)/autoconf(2.61)/libtool(1.5.22) as shown here:
$ automake --version
automake (GNU automake) 1.9.6

$ autoconf --version
autoconf (GNU Autoconf) 2.61

$ libtool --version
ltmain.sh (GNU libtool) 1.5.22 (1.1220.2.365 2005/12/18 22:14:06)


Anything I may miss?
